Package com.vaadin.ui

Examples of com.vaadin.ui.TabSheet.addTab()


        setMainWindow(mainWin);

        setTheme("tests-tickets");
        TabSheet ts = new TabSheet();

        ts.addTab(new CustomLayout("Ticket1519_News"), "News", null);
        ts.addTab(new CustomLayout("Ticket1519_Support"), "Support", null);

        mainWin.addComponent(ts);

    }
View Full Code Here


        setTheme("tests-tickets");
        TabSheet ts = new TabSheet();

        ts.addTab(new CustomLayout("Ticket1519_News"), "News", null);
        ts.addTab(new CustomLayout("Ticket1519_Support"), "Support", null);

        mainWin.addComponent(ts);

    }
}
View Full Code Here

    protected TabSheet createTabSheet() {
        TabSheet ts = new TabSheet();
        Table t = createTable();
        t.setSizeFull();
        ts.addTab(t, "Size full Table", ICON_16_USER_PNG_UNCACHEABLE);
        ts.addTab(new Button("A button"), "Button", null);
        return ts;
    }

    private void createComponentAttachListener(String category) {
View Full Code Here

    protected TabSheet createTabSheet() {
        TabSheet ts = new TabSheet();
        Table t = createTable();
        t.setSizeFull();
        ts.addTab(t, "Size full Table", ICON_16_USER_PNG_UNCACHEABLE);
        ts.addTab(new Button("A button"), "Button", null);
        return ts;
    }

    private void createComponentAttachListener(String category) {
        createBooleanAction("Component attach listener", category, false,
View Full Code Here

        final VerticalLayout tab1 = new VerticalLayout();
        tab1.addComponent(new Label("try tab2"));
        final VerticalLayout tab2 = new VerticalLayout();
        test(tab2);
        populateLayout(tab2);
        tabsheet.addTab(tab1, "TabSheet tab1", new ClassResource("m.gif"));
        tabsheet.addTab(tab2, "TabSheet tab2", new ClassResource("m.gif"));

        final VerticalLayout expandLayout = new VerticalLayout();
        test(expandLayout);
        populateLayout(expandLayout);
View Full Code Here

        tab1.addComponent(new Label("try tab2"));
        final VerticalLayout tab2 = new VerticalLayout();
        test(tab2);
        populateLayout(tab2);
        tabsheet.addTab(tab1, "TabSheet tab1", new ClassResource("m.gif"));
        tabsheet.addTab(tab2, "TabSheet tab2", new ClassResource("m.gif"));

        final VerticalLayout expandLayout = new VerticalLayout();
        test(expandLayout);
        populateLayout(expandLayout);
View Full Code Here

        assertEquals(2, tabSheet.getTabPosition(tab2));
        assertEquals(3, tabSheet.getTabPosition(tab5));
        assertEquals(4, tabSheet.getTabPosition(tab3));

        // Calling addTab with existing component does not move tab
        tabSheet.addTab(tab1.getComponent(), 3);

        assertEquals(0, tabSheet.getTabPosition(tab1));
        assertEquals(1, tabSheet.getTabPosition(tab4));
        assertEquals(2, tabSheet.getTabPosition(tab2));
        assertEquals(3, tabSheet.getTabPosition(tab5));
View Full Code Here

    }

    @Test
    public void addTabWithAllParameters() {
        TabSheet tabSheet = new TabSheet();
        Tab tab1 = tabSheet.addTab(new Label("aaa"));
        Tab tab2 = tabSheet.addTab(new Label("bbb"));
        Tab tab3 = tabSheet.addTab(new Label("ccc"));

        Tab tab4 = tabSheet.addTab(new Label("ddd"), "ddd", null, 1);
        Tab tab5 = tabSheet.addTab(new Label("eee"), "eee", null, 3);
View Full Code Here

    @Test
    public void addTabWithAllParameters() {
        TabSheet tabSheet = new TabSheet();
        Tab tab1 = tabSheet.addTab(new Label("aaa"));
        Tab tab2 = tabSheet.addTab(new Label("bbb"));
        Tab tab3 = tabSheet.addTab(new Label("ccc"));

        Tab tab4 = tabSheet.addTab(new Label("ddd"), "ddd", null, 1);
        Tab tab5 = tabSheet.addTab(new Label("eee"), "eee", null, 3);
View Full Code Here

    @Test
    public void addTabWithAllParameters() {
        TabSheet tabSheet = new TabSheet();
        Tab tab1 = tabSheet.addTab(new Label("aaa"));
        Tab tab2 = tabSheet.addTab(new Label("bbb"));
        Tab tab3 = tabSheet.addTab(new Label("ccc"));

        Tab tab4 = tabSheet.addTab(new Label("ddd"), "ddd", null, 1);
        Tab tab5 = tabSheet.addTab(new Label("eee"), "eee", null, 3);

        assertEquals(0, tabSheet.getTabPosition(tab1));
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.